Intro

The Movement crafts a sound that feels like the evolution of the American reggae-rock movement, trading gritty garage vibes for a sophisticated, high-fidelity experience. Their music is anchored by heavy, melodic basslines and crisp percussion, but it is the interplay of Josh Swain’s unique vocal delivery - alternating between smooth singing and rapid-fire rhythmic flows - that defines their sonic identity.

What truly sets them apart is their willingness to incorporate expansive, almost cinematic synth textures and progressive song structures that go beyond the standard three-chord reggae loop. There is a spiritual, grounded quality to their songwriting that avoids clichés, focusing instead on personal growth, connectivity, and the natural world. The production is consistently lush, making use of deep dub delays and perfectly stacked vocal harmonies.

Newcomers should dive into 'Golden' or 'Ways of the World' to hear the band at their peak of polish and songwriting. These albums represent the gold standard of the modern 'Cali-reggae' scene, even though the band’s roots trace back to the East Coast. It is the perfect soundtrack for anyone who wants the groove of reggae with the lyrical density of hip-hop and the production value of modern indie-rock.
